State: Michigan
Disc Golf Holes: 9
Disc Golf Course Length: 2700 feet
Disc Golf Tee Type: Dirt
Disc Golf Target Type: DB5

Disc Golf

Seasonal course on the ski hill. First half of the course is open with a few trees and ski lift towers as obstacles, the second half follows narrower ski trails up and around the mountain. Bring map to aid with navigation. Public (No Fee)Courtesy of DiscGolfUnited.com

Half a mile north of US Hwy 2 in Ironwood, MI. 1st tee is in front of the deck at the back of the ski hill chalet.Courtesy of DiscGolfUnited.com
